Azzi Family History

Azzi Surname Meaning

Arabic (Lebanon and Maghreb): adjectival derivative denoting descent or association of a short form of the personal name ʿIzz al-dīn (in Maghreb usually spelled Azzeddine) meaning ‘glory of the religion’ (from ʿizz ‘glory’ and dīn ‘religion’). Bearers of this surname are both Muslims and Christians.

Italian: patronymic or plural form of the personal name Azzo, a name of ancient Germanic origin probably from atha ‘nobility’ or atta ‘father’.

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Azzi family from?

You can see how Azzi families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Azzi family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there were 2 Azzi families living in Michigan. This was about 20% of all the recorded Azzi's in USA. Michigan and 1 other state had the highest population of Azzi families in 1920.

What did your Azzi 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Laborer was the top reported job for people in the USA named Azzi. 34% of Azzi men worked as a Laborer.
